>Hi guys, I have a G4/450 AGP with two IDE drives, a Maxtor 40GB set to >slave and a WD 27GB set to master. The Maxtor has the active OSX >software (10.1.5). Do you think there will be a difference in >performance if I switch the Maxtor to master so that it will be the >boot drive instead on now booting off the slave drive? BTW I have 384MB >RAM.
I don't think so, If I remember correctly the only thing which effects performance on a Master/Slave config is the fact that performance of both drives is governed by the slowest drive. So if you have an ATA/66, and an ATA/100 on the same cable the ATA/100 will only work at ATA/66 speeds regardless of the bus they're connected to.
